Gendarmerie personnel on duty in the Başkale district in Turkey’s city of Van at an altitude of 2.400 meters, doesn’t forget the animals despite 22 degrees below zero cold. In the previous days, the gendarmerie personnel on duty at the traffic control point at the Bebleşin are on the Van-Hakkari highway, noticed a fox coming towards them on the road. Thought that the fox was hungry, the gendarmerie went up beside to the animal. Gendarmerie personnel fed the fox, which couldn’t find food due to snow and was starving for a long time, with their bare hands. Those moments were recorded by a personnel’s mobile phone camera.

Srebrenica Genocide Victims Laid to Rest on 30th Anniversary

Seven newly identified victims of the 1995 Srebrenica genocide were buried at the Potocari Memorial Cemetery in Bosnia and Herzegovina on the 30th anniversary of the massacre. The genocide, recognized by international courts, claimed over 8,300 Muslim lives during the Bosnian War.

The ceremony drew leaders and officials from across the region and Europe, including Turkish Parliament Speaker Numan Kurtulmuş, Croatian Prime Minister Andrej Plenković, and French and NATO representatives.

Bosnian official Denis Bećirović emphasized the years of propaganda and planning that led to the genocide, while French President Emmanuel Macron warned that denialism has no place in EU-aspiring nations. NATO’s Mark Rutte called it a lasting tragedy linking the Netherlands and Bosnia.

Sirens marked the remembrance across cities, and symbolic tributes—including a silent jump from Mostar Bridge and the release of lilies—honored the victims. The newly buried include victims aged between 17 and 67.
